it's all been done and tested, from an exhaust only you might get 5bhp but you loose torque up the rev range with the fabspeed so a big NO NO for me

you get more torque at 3k revs but who is driving a GT4 at 3k revs !!! you will never see 3k revs bar in 1st gear.

if you do the correct mods which is tried and tested you will see a real 415BHp, as the restriction is, the GT4 uses the standard Cayman 72/74mm throttle body NOT the 991 one which is 83mm.

so you can fit all the st you like, the throttle body is restricting the air in, so hence fitting an exhaust is pointless.

One owner from who fitted the IPD thought they lost power so took it back off.
